Secondhand Smoke - Are Your Children At Risk?
If you're a smoker, you're putting your children at risk for developing a lung disease as an adult. Studies show that children of smokers are 3.6 times more likely to develop lung cancer as an adult. Find out how secondhand smoke is damaging our children.
